Description

The Foxboro FEM100 (P0973CA) is a high-performance Fieldbus Expansion Module designed to extend the communication capabilities of the I/A Series Distributed Control System (DCS). This module serves as a critical bridge, allowing for the expansion of the Fieldbus to accommodate additional Fieldbus Modules (FBMs) across multiple baseplates. It is primarily utilized in large-scale industrial operations such as petrochemical complexes, pharmaceutical plants, and massive power generation facilities where high I/O density is required. The FEM100 ensures that real-time data integrity and deterministic communication are maintained across expanded network segments.

Network Architecture

The FEM100 architecture is optimized for transparent signal repetition and bus extension. It interfaces directly with the 2 Mbps Fieldbus, regenerating and buffering signals to overcome distance and loading limitations inherent in high-speed serial communication. The module supports redundant Fieldbus configurations, providing two independent communication paths (Path A and Path B) to ensure that the control network remains operational even if one cable segment is compromised. It acts as an active node that monitors bus health and provides isolation between baseplate segments, preventing local electrical faults from propagating through the entire Fieldbus string.

Technical Specifications

Model FEM100 (P0973CA)
Module Type Fieldbus Expansion / Repeater Module
Communication Rate 2 Mbps
Redundancy Dual-Redundant Fieldbus Paths
Power Consumption 2.8 Watts (Maximum)
Operating Temperature 0 to 60 deg C
Storage Temperature -40 to +70 deg C
Relative Humidity 5 to 95% (non-condensing)

Installation Guidelines

  • Ensure the system is powered down before inserting or removing the module from the baseplate.
  • Verify that the baseplate is properly grounded to maintain signal integrity and EMI protection.
  • Handle the module using ESD-safe practices to prevent damage to internal circuitry.
  • Ensure proper ventilation in the cabinet to maintain operating temperatures within the 0 to 60 deg C range.
  • Check for secure seating in the baseplate slot to ensure reliable electrical contact with the Fieldbus backplane.
